Pentalog reporting a 55% growth in production for the first quarter

 

Pentalog's production for the first quarter will be 55% higher than in the first quarter of 2008, and 5 points ahead of forecast. The Hanoi office will not make a significant contribution before April. The growth is mainly due to the two newest offices in Romania: Iasi (opened in 2007) and Sibiu (opened in 2008). 
It is mostly related to our clients in the telecom field. Our Embedded software production contract with ST-Ericsson has reached a level of approximately 40 engineers working full time. Pentalog Deutschland has signed a deal with LHS-Ericsson, number one on the global mobile phone invoicing market. A 27 member team will be in charge of this contract. Today, 11 engineers are already working full time in Romania.

In the consumer goods sector, Pentalog won a contract with one of the leaders in the tobacco industry. It will involve 40 engineers. This project will take place in Moldova and Vietnam.

In the travelling industry, Pentalog Technology, the joint-venture with the Ausy Group, has signed a contract with Karavel Promovacances. The project has just been started in Brasov, Romania.

100% of our clients using dedicated teams have renewed their deals with Pentalog. Some have even increased the requested amount of services. In order to meet their needs, Pentalog will have to recruit 80 people in Romania, Moldova and in Vietnam, before the end of June 2009.
